Rudloe Community Centre
We are pleased to report that our bid to occupy the Rudloe Community Centre, as set out on Monday night at the special church meeting, was approved unanimously by the Wiltshire Council Area Board. It will now go forward to the Cabinet for consideration and a final decision. We give praise to God for continuing to go before us with this project and thank you all for your prayers. Please continue to pray for this next important step in the journey.

Join us as we mark the 200 year anniversary of CBC!
Join us on 29th October for a very special service in the history of CBC – as we celebrate our 200th anniversary! As a family, we’ll reflect on the Lord’s faithfulness and provision over the years and respond in praise! We’re delighted that ministers past and present will be with us including Graham Culver, Eddie Larkman, Rob Durant and Adam Jacques.
While we look back on God’s goodness and his care for us, we will also look outward into our community as we celebrate harvest. Everyone is invited to bring a longer-life food item to donate. These contributions will go directly to our Souper Friday ministry. This is a very practical way we can help local families in our community, and share God’s love. (If you’d like some ideas for what to donate, have a look here at items that are in demand.) Alternatively, you are welcome to make a monetary donation; these gifts will go to Tearfund.
We look forward to this service and hope you can join us for this historic event as we praise and worship God together.
